Wendell Bradley Singletary, Sr.

August 18, 1961 — April 23, 2018

Wendell Bradley Singletary, Sr., 56, a lifelong resident of Valdosta, passed away on Monday, April 23, 2018 at his residence. He was born on August 18, 1961 to the late Norman Morris and Ila V. Daniels Singletary. Wendell was a member of Remerton Methodist Church. He worked with ham radios, and collected guns, old records, and antiques. He loved muscle cars, and enjoyed shopping at Goodwill, always searching for treasures. He enjoyed the beach, where he liked to catch crabs at night. He loved spending time with his family and was crazy about his granddaughter. He would give you the shirt off his back and loved helping others. Wendell had a wonderful sense of humor and could make you believe anything. He was nicknamed the Joker and loved to make others laugh.
Wendell is survived by his wife Crystal Lynn Singletary, of Valdosta, his son Wendell Bradley Singletary, Jr. (Alyssa Redding) of Brunswick, his daughters, Suzanne Brooke Singletary, of Michigan, Macy Dakota Youngblood, and Cali Jordon Youngblood, both of Valdosta, his granddaughter Madelyn Christina Corrao, of Valdosta, two brothers Phillip (Carol) Singletary, of Valdosta, and Norman Craig Singletary, of Savannah, his half brothers Raymond (Madge) Allen, of Texas, and Charles Allen, of Oklahoma, his half sister Mary Cagle of Oklahoma, two sisters Sheila Elaine Longbreak, and Sybil Jean (Bob) Pridgen, both of Valdosta, and many nieces and nephews.
Funeral services will be held on Friday, April 27, 2018 at 2 p.m. in the chapel of the Carson McLane Funeral Home. Burial will follow at Sunset Hill Cemetery.
